Geth1b — find the jobs that will sponsor you

Every year, tens of thousands of international graduates in the U.S. apply to companies that will never sponsor them. Not because they aren't qualified, but because nowhere does it say which employers actually file H-1B petitions, which quietly stopped this year, and which are exempt from the lottery.

That information exists — scattered across government filings and tens of thousands of company career systems. Nobody had assembled it. We did, and we redo it every day.

EZ Waimao AI

Feature-complete · servers paused
FIG 01 — DOCUMENT CHAIN

A full ERP built for small trading companies — at a size and price they can actually run.

  • Inquiry, quote, order, shipment and invoice run as one chain — each document turns into the next instead of being retyped
  • Chinese, U.S. GAAP and IFRS books kept in parallel, multiple ledgers, consolidated reporting
  • Inventory down to batch and serial number, expiry-first outbound, and shelf age visible at a glance
  • The AI assistant reads the documents you upload and fills the fields in for you

Senior Benefits Navigator

Data ready · interface in build
FIG 03 — ELIGIBILITY MATCH

Millions of older Americans qualify for benefits they have never heard of.

  • Matched county by county, because U.S. benefits differ by county and a national answer helps nobody
  • 46,549 facilities and 6,224 referral agencies indexed, down to the individual provider
  • Backed by 3.37 million rows of county-level Medicare Advantage enrolment data
  • It answers the question that matters: what am I eligible for, and where do I claim it
Senior Benefits Navigator matching a 68-year-old to 35 programs
Four questions in: a 68-year-old on a limited income qualifies for 35 programs — most of which they have never heard of.
